Iran’s Live‑Fire Drill at the Strait of Hormuz Raises Stakes for Global Energy and US–China–Russia Calculus

Iran has announced live‑fire naval drills in the Strait of Hormuz on 1–2 February, warning it could impose temporary closures and showcasing new capabilities including large numbers of drones. The move raises the risk of disruptions to global oil supplies and tests the responses of the United States, regional actors and potential backers such as China and Russia.

U.S. Readies Forces for Possible Strike on Iran as Tensions Rise Around Strait of Hormuz

The United States has told Israel that preparations for possible military action against Iran should be completed within two weeks, while retaining the option to act sooner if ordered by President Trump. The deployment of the Abraham Lincoln carrier strike group and other assets has heightened risks around the strategically vital Strait of Hormuz, where Iran says it monitors and controls maritime passage and would treat third-party use of territory against Iran as hostile.

Iran Declares Full Military Readiness, Threatens Widespread Response from Hormuz to U.S. Interests

Iranian parliamentary security officials said on January 25 that the country's armed forces are on full alert and warned of broad retaliation — from the Strait of Hormuz to U.S. regional assets — should Tehran face any attack. The rhetoric follows U.S. announcements of increased naval and missile‑defence deployments, heightening the risk of miscalculation with implications for regional security and global energy markets.
